Who did the OD refurb? OD Spares or Overdrive services? One or maybe both of those can have your gearbox rebuilt at the same time as you're having your OD done. M40 boxes not hard to find. Synchros getting difficult but the ones working with the higher gears don't wear much so can be used for refurb purposes as they are all the same AFAIK.
